“It is during the middle grades that students either launch toward achievement and attainment, or slide off track toward a direction of frustration, failure, and ultimately early exit from the only secure path to adult success.” (Balfanz, R. 2007)
Schools that pay attention to transition and have an intentional transition plan see more success in increasing achievement and reducing retentions. Having an effective transition program contributes to developing a positive learning environment. Both sending and receiving schools need to work collaboratively with each other, and with families to provide ongoing support for students as they experience the transition to the middle grades.

According to the National Education Association (NEA) President Dennis Roekel, "research and field-work show that parent-school partnerships improve schools, strengthen families, build community support, and increase student achievement and success" (Roekel, 2008, para. 5). Schools cannot work alone in getting students to improve learning.
There has to be a structured, strategic plan that includes other stakeholders. A variety of potential community groups such as police officers, firefighters, civil rights, and youth services organizations are great examples of resources that can be involved in the teaching and learning process. Consider the benefits of seeking out this type of community support? What are some of the first steps in garnering the support of these leaders within the community? Additionally, when students get involved with this strategic planning in developing community relationships through service learning projects, the outcomes prove positive for social growth and academic development. The benefits of service learning project can be seen in the Service Learning: You Can Make a Difference (Links to an external site.) one and half minute video.
The first step in establishing a successful partnership between schools and community is the initial planning phase. This sets the foundation by assessing the school’s needs, establishing goals and objectives, and developing a vision for the future. One of the key factors is getting those individuals involved who have a genuine interest and care about what happens to the schools within the community. Price (2008) explains that through the “community mobilization” process, schools engage the community to create a list of community priorities, resources, needs, and solutions that promote stakeholder accountability and positive student support. He believes that by "mobilizing the village" and having community meetings related to education, support for education can be garnered (Price, 2008, p. 90). The concern, however, is recruiting school and community volunteers who will spearhead these partnerships. Educators may not feel qualified to assume this role, or may not have enough time to add another responsibility to their already-full plate. Price suggest that the key to getting teachers involved in creating partnerships is by tapping into their professional interest in community-based efforts in improving student success.

Case Study 1
The New Classroom Responds
There are many aspects of our culture that do not traditionally assume a democracy would work in a successful operation. An example of this is a grade school classroom. It is generally assumed that the students have no say in what they are taught, and the teachers are the ones who lay everything out and tell their students what to do and when to do it. The idea of strictly teaching academic skills in the classroom has been accepted in the past however recent studies show that implementing a democratic-style of learning can improve the students social outcomes in addition to academic knowledge. A particular case regarding this subject is the Social and Academic Learning Study to gain a better understanding of the Responsive Classroom approach. Based out of Stamford, CT, this case was investigated by Dr. Sara Rimm-Kaufman from the University of Virginia and it lasted three years.
The use of a democratic system in the classroom from grades K – 8 has traditionally never been thought of an ideal teaching and learning practice. It is not until recent that studies have proven these prior notions to be incorrect. With a Responsive Classroom implemented social skills are enforced just as much as academic skills. Additionally, another aspect of the Responsive Learning System is that the social relations aid the learning process.
According to the Responsive Classroom approach at rsponsiveclassroom.com there are six practices used in the system. Those six strategies are the following: “morning meeting, rules and logical consequences, guided activity, academic choice, classroom organization, and family communication strategies.”
The morning session involved in the Responsive Classroom is a great way to bring a democratic approach to teaching. During this session students interact with one another discuss what needs to be accomplished throughout the day how it is going to get done. Rather than just “jumping in” to the days lesson, the teacher can use this time to hear the opinions of the students. Not only does this make the process easier on the students, it lifts up team morale for student and teacher alike. The traditional train of thought that democracy in the classroom cannot work is proven wrong.
In addition, through the Responsive Classroom a clear guideline of rules and regulations are set forth for the students to understand. By knowing the rules and consequences students can teach themselves to obey the classroom guidelines. This gives the students a lot more responsibility and freedom to think for themselves.
Another key factor of the Responsive Classroom is the “guided discovery” style of teaching. Rather than presenting students with a textbook and having them read and answer questions on the text, this method goes a lot farther. Operation “Blue Star” is the only event in the history of Independent India where the state went into war with its own people. Even after about 40 years it is not clear if it was culmination of states anger over people of the region, a political game of power or start of dictatorial chapter in the democratic setup.
The people of Punjab felt alienated from main stream due to denial of their just demands during a long democratic struggle since independence. As it happen all over the word, it led to militant struggle with great loss of lives of military, police and civilian personnel. Killing of Indira Gandhi and massacre of innocent Sikhs in Delhi and other India cities was also associated with this movement.

Published classroom materials form the basis of syllabuses, drive teacher professional development, and have a potentially huge influence on learners, teachers and education systems. All teachers also create their own materials, whether a few sentences on a blackboard, a highly-structured fully-realised online course, or anything in between. Despite this, the knowledge and skills needed to create effective language learning materials are rarely part of teacher training, and are mostly learnt by trial and error.
Knowledge and skills frameworks, generally called competency frameworks, for ELT teachers, trainers and managers have existed for a few years now. However, until I created one for my MA dissertation, there wasn’t one drawing together what we need to know and do to be able to effectively produce language learning materials.
